Transaction eca6c422b1409be19f66c032d164d0c171ab4403222c34f6837d8b07327a9230
1 Input
1 Output
-
eca6c422b1409be19f66c032d164d0c171ab4403222c34f6837d8b07327a9230:0
- value
- 397419002
- script pubkey
- OP_0 OP_PUSHBYTES_20 844c901ba9667db1fe5d277a28a074e9c1fb44d4
- address
- bc1qs3xfqxafve7mrljayaaz3gr5a8qlk3x5eamj0j